Ordinals
beta
Sat 250380494100737
decimal
50076.494100737
degree
0°50076′1692″494100737‴
percentile
11.92288068457884%
name
mbqdsplwmpc
cycle
0
epoch
0
period
24
block
50076
offset
494100737
timestamp
2010-04-10 22:24:16 UTC
rarity
common
prev
next